Jennifer López reaches the top position in the country this week with the worldwide hit “On The Floor”.   The last time we saw Jennifer in the charts was back in November 2007 with “Do It Well” which only reached #18.   However, J Lo had previously hit the top spot with a few other songs such as “If You Had My Love”, “No Me Ames” (duet with Marc Anthony) and “Waiting For Tonight” back in 1999.

 

Marco Di Mauro and Maité Perroni gain back 4 positions with “A Partir De Hoy”, and they are back to the top 5 again.   The song comes from a Mexican soap opera which has a large audience in Latin America.

 

The Black Eyed Peas gain the Power Airplay of the week at #7, while Franco De Vita continues climbing the charts with “Tan Sólo Tú”, and this week jumps 7 to #11.

 

There are two new songs in the chart this week – at #26, Shakira with another hit from her latest album, “Rabiosa” and the hot shot debut belongs to the dance hit by LMFAO at #25, “Party Rock Anthem”.
